Formation of diamond/NiCrAl cermet coating through cold spray

Abstract

Diamond/NiCrAl composite powder was prepared by mechanical alloying using diamond powder and NiCrAl alloy powder. Cold spray was used to deposit ultra-hard diamond/NiCrAl cermet coating. The effect of diamond content on the characteristics of the milled powder and the as-sprayed coating was investigated. The results show that the microstructure, the particle size distribution and the grain size of the milled powder was significantly influenced by the ball milling parameters. The microstructure of the spray particles was completely retained in the coating. It was revealed that diamond particles distribution in the milled powder evidently influence the hardness of the cold sprayed coating.
